AI/ML Engineer, Platform and Agents

HybridWaltham, Massachusetts, United States

Full Time

Job Summary

Build internal AI agents and workflow tools that help scientists query data, interpret model outputs, and make design decisions. Integrate synthesis, assay, ELN/LIMS, and computational data into model-ready layers supporting repeatable learning loops. Orchestrate lab-in-the-loop modeling workflows connecting design, synthesis, testing, analysis, and next-round recommendations. Partner with lab automation and scientific software colleagues to improve data capture and traceability. Build applications, APIs, and data services exposing ML capabilities to scientific users while maintaining internal ownership of scientific requirements. Contribute to platform governance and documentation for model use in project decisions. Work with outsourced infrastructure partners to ensure strong scientific control.
